Review from clo:

[FONT=verdana, helvetica, arial][SIZE=-1]Edit no. 1 - Garden of delights - spring dresses with Sasha, Caroline Trentini, Karen Elson and Gemma all wearing short black wigs, shot by Steven Meisel.
Beauties of the moment - article and lovely pics on flowers
One Fine Day - article and pics on Nicole Kidman by Mario Testino.
edit no. 2 - Where the Wild Things Are - Caroline Trentini by Arthur Elgort. Elgort sure knows a lot about his business and, although I'm not a Trentini fan, I have to say she looks beautiful and incredibly healthy.
Court favourite - article with pics by Testino on Roger Federer.
Unbeatable - article on food.
Euroflash - article and pics on young European socialites. Yikes!!!
edit no. 3 - Silver Screen Dreams - Angela Lindvall shot by Miles Aldridge. Angela looks glorious in this editorial.
